comment
This is when a character or characters look off to some far distant point or do an Aside Glance to instigate a Flashback or Imagine Spot. Expect the screen to do a wishy-washy thing that blurs the screen or a fade of some sort. If the stare goes on for too long you hope it's being used for comedic effect ala Inner Thoughts, Outsider Puzzlement. Something of a Discredited Trope these days: many comedies will have other characters confused at the actions, or trying to wake them from their spaced out state.
Compare Pensieve Flashback, in which the character is immersed in the scene he's remembering, and Thousand-Yard Stare, which this trope is built from.

comment
The Simpsons:
In one episode, Moe turns his back on Barney to deliver one of these stares in the middle of a conversation. Barney, confused, asks, "Moe?"
In another episode, Homer yells at Bart for staring while he's having a The Wonder Years moment.
In another Marge does one of these, and comes out of it saying "And that's why I can't say 'no' to people." Homer points out that he has no idea what she was thinking about. "Why would you think I did?"

comment
In the Extant episode A Pack of Cards Molly enters a flashback after staring at a police car. This triggers a memory of her accident 10 years ago involving Marcus and the death of her unborn child. Later in the same episode she does it again. This time however it's a forced dream state brought on by the child; creating a fantasy world after the crash where Marcus and the baby never died.

Invoked hilariously by Mystery Science Theater 3000 for a fifties short about how to know when you're ready to get married. At one point, while the "marriage counselor over at the church" is talking, the female half of the couple he's advising stares into space for several seconds, apparently not listening. Mike and the robots fill the seconds with gunshot noises and an imitation of an officer bellowing, "Marines, we are leaving!", and when the woman shakes herself back into focus, Mike has her say, "Sorry, back in Danang there for a minute."

Battlestar Galactica (2003) episode Valley of Darkness features Colonel Tigh under pressure from all sides with nobody of any experience to turn to. He ends up having flashbacks to when he first meets Commander Adama. While in the final edit most of these are cut; extended scenes shows quite a few long ones with the Colonel staring into space, some of which do make it in the final cut but without the actual flashbacks.
